Permit Requirements in Severy
Know when you need a permit to ensure your project is legal and safe
General Rules
Roofing permits in Severy ensure work meets safety standards for wind, fire, and structure.
They're often required for anything beyond minor spot fixes to protect homeowners and the community.
When Permits Are Required
Permits typically needed for:
- Full roof replacements or re-roofing
- New installations or overlays
- Structural changes like truss work or height adjustments
- Most commercial roofing projects
Verify square footage thresholds with local authorities.
Common Exemptions
Common exemptions:
- Minor repairs (e.g., a few shingles)
- Routine cleaning or sealing
- Like-for-like patches without demo
Exemptions vary – confirm locally.

Permit Process
1. Confirm Need
Describe your project to local building officials to see if a permit is required.
2. Prepare Docs
Gather property details, contractor info, roofing specs, and simple plans.
3. Submit App
File the application with your local department – online or in-person.
4. Review & Revise
Officials check for code compliance; address any feedback.
5. Work & Inspect
Perform work and schedule inspections at key stages (e.g., underlayment, final).
6. Get Approval
Pass final inspection for occupancy certificate or sign-off.

Special Considerations
HOA Rules
HOA rules may apply first. Many Severy neighborhoods require HOA approval for roofing materials, colors, or styles before city permits.
Zoning
Zoning checks cover roof pitch, materials, and setbacks. Confirm compliance for additions or commercial sites.
Historic Properties
Historic properties often need extra design reviews to match original features. Check if your home qualifies.
